3 Reasons Not to Use a 15-Amp Extension Cord on a 20-Amp Breaker

  1. The breaker won’t protect the cord A 20-amp breaker allows up to 20 amps before tripping, but a 15-amp cord can overheat and catch fire at currents above 15 amps. The breaker protects the wall wiring, not the extension cord.

  2. A surge or added load can exceed the cord’s rating Even if your current draw is under 15 amps, a short, surge, or plugging in another device can push the current over 15 amps. The cord will overheat before the breaker trips.

  3. The risk of fire is not worth the convenience A 15-amp cord on a 20-amp circuit makes the cord the weak link. If it fails, you get a fire, not a tripped breaker. Use a 20-amp rated cord or a different outlet instead.
